March is like any other month, with lots of school and work. However, there is a holiday that celebrates hard-working people. International Women’s Day. Every year, on March 8th, we celebrate women.

Women do a lot of things for everyone. Mothers give life and sometimes other women have to take the role of a mother. Women have created many things that help us in our daily lives as well.

Did you know that the home security system was created by a woman? That’s right, Marie Van Brittan Brown created home security systems. Without her invention, danger could have struck all of us. There are also many other things that were created by women as well. The fold-out bed, the dishwasher, the car heater, and feeding tubes were all invented by women.

Some of these inventions have saved lives! Feeding tubes for example. Feeding tubes help nourish babies and people who are unable to eat by themselves. Something simple as a car heater is also an invention that comforts. Imagine driving while the cold weather outside seeks inside your car. If you’re stuck in a blizzard, without a car heater and no help on the way, your life inside the car would be miserable.
